PostHeaderIcon LIBRARY Re-Opens With New Facilities


SOUTH West Library, Barr's Cottage, Greenock has re-opened to the public after a £300,000 six-month refurbishment.

Work included a new roof and double-glazing; complete redecoration with new bookshelves, counter and furniture.

There is a state-of-the-art learning zone with interactive whiteboard; more public access computers with free wi-fi; bright comfortable children's area; young adult area with study space; a coffee machine and comfortable seating. An induction loop is also provided for the benefit of people with hearing difficulties.

Some work is still being carried out including improved accessibility with a ramp, automatic doors and an adapted toilet suitable for wheelchair users. The public toilet also offers baby changing facilities.

An official launch with a special guest will follow as soon as the project is totally complete.
